What is the Student Promissory Note?
The Student Promissory Note serves as a financial agreement between North Central College and its students, specifically pertaining to the Summer Term 2012. This document outlines the responsibilities of students regarding tuition and fees, ensuring that they clearly understand their commitments.
Essentially, a Student Promissory Note is a formal declaration in which students promise to pay the specified amounts. This agreement emphasizes the importance of financial responsibility, particularly for students enrolled during this designated term.
Purpose and Benefits of the Student Promissory Note
This financial agreement is crucial, as it ensures acknowledgment of financial commitments for tuition and fees. By signing the Student Promissory Note, students affirm their understanding of their obligations, which fosters accountability.
The note also outlines the consequences of non-payment, which may include additional fees and the potential for collection actions. This clarity additionally facilitates the processing of tuition payments, making financial management simpler for students.

Who is eligible to fill out the Student Promissory Note?
The Student Promissory Note is specifically for students enrolled at North Central College, particularly those responsible for tuition payments during the Summer Term 2012.
When was the deadline for submitting the Student Promissory Note?
The Student Promissory Note for the Summer Term 2012 was due by July 27, 2012. Submitting after this date may lead to penalties.
